COMPANY OVERVIEW:

Knoll, Inc. is a constellation of design-driven brands and people, working together with our clients in person and digitally to create inspired modern interiors. Our internationally recognized portfolio includes furniture, textiles, leathers, lighting, accessories, and architectural and acoustical elements. Our brands — Knoll Office, KnollStudio, KnollTextiles, KnollExtra, Spinneybeck | FilzFelt, Edelman Leather, HOLLY HUNT, DatesWeiser, Muuto, and Fully — reflect our commitment to modern design that meets the diverse requirements of high-performance workplaces, work from home settings and luxury residential interiors. A recipient of the National Design Award for Corporate and Institutional Achievement from the Smithsonian's Cooper-Hewitt, National Design Museum, we can help organizations achieve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design (LEED), Living Building Challenge and WELL Building workplace certifications. POSITION PROFILE:

A Sales Representative is responsible for maximizing and growing revenue and profits within his/her assigned geography by expanding opportunities in existing customers and acquiring new business. The key responsibility of a Sales Representative is to conduct business in a way that creates a superior customer experience that will set the stage for effective sales follow-up, as well as long term relationships and future product sales. Key responsibilities:

Research accounts, identify key players, generate interest and develop accounts to buy furniture.

Develop and maintain relationships with influencers in the market including Architects, Designers, Contractors, Brokers and/or other influencers involved in or related to the furniture and design industry

Drive sales through product and workplace knowledge which will enable you to align key business objectives of clients.

Become a trusted resource and develop superior long term relationships with customers

Successfully manage and overcome customer objections

Update customer interaction in salesforce.com to ensure efficient lead management. Utilize saleforce.com daily to manage forecast

Maintain an appropriate level of sales activity at all times by conducting a minimum number of sales appointments per week as designated by the Regional Leader

Develop and deploy, individually and collaboratively, virtual and in person engagements with customers and influencers

Work closely with internal and dealer resources to produce industry leading proposals and other sales materials.

Monitor market conditions, product innovations and competitors’ products, prices and sales

Partner with dealer/distribution personal to achieve objectives listed above

Required Skills

Exhibits a work style that is high energy, highly influential and can be an aggressive closer

Proven track record achieving measurable sales goals as assigned by Regional Leader and willing to accept responsibility for results

Strong interpersonal communication, presentation and negotiation skills, including verbal, written and proposal form

Ability to communicate effectively with customers, associates, managers, outside and inside contacts

Ability to work with their sales teams and be an individual contributor

Positive and energetic with excellent listening skills and strong writing skills

Possess an entrepreneurial spirit with the highest level of integrity

Required Experience

BA/BS in Interior Design/Marketing/Business preferred

Requires a minimum of three to five years selling experience

Self-motivated, self-directed with a track record of successful, credible lead follow-up and sales development at multiple levels within an organization

salesforce.com experience and understanding a plus
